What Does Error Code PE Mean on a Samsung Washing Machine?
Water pressure sensor (pressure switch) failure.
PE fires when the control board reads an out-of-range or implausible signal from the analog water-level pressure sensor, which converts tub air-column pressure into a frequency the board uses to gauge fill. The code triggers on an open, shorted, or drifting sensor, or when a kinked or blocked pressure hose prevents pressure from reaching it. Unlike OE (overflow) or nF/4E (no-fill) codes that indicate actual water problems, PE points specifically to the sensing circuit itself misreporting the level.
What Causes Error Code PE?
Here are the most common causes in order of frequency. Start with the most likely cause before moving to the next:
- 1 Pressure sensor failed (open or shorted) 55% of cases
- 2 Pressure hose kinked or blocked 30% of cases
- 3 Control board pressure sensor input failure 15% of cases
How to Fix Samsung Washing Machine Error Code PE
- 1
Check the pressure hose
The pressure hose runs from the outer tub up to the pressure sensor. Check for kinks, cracks, or blockages. Blow gently through the hose — you should hear the sensor click.
- 2
Test the pressure sensor
The sensor should audibly click when you blow into the hose connection. Test electrical continuity at each water level position.

Replace the pressure sensor
The sensor is usually accessed by removing the top panel. Disconnect the hose and wiring, unscrew, and swap.

How to Reset Error Code PE
After repair, unplug for 1 minute then restart.
Note: If the error returns after resetting, the underlying issue has not been resolved. Work through the fix steps above.

When to Call a Professional
If a new pressure sensor and clear hose don't resolve PE, the control board sensor input has failed.
